Title: Scheduler double-waters bed 3 after DST shift

New folks: the Verdella scheduler stores watering slots in local time. After the clock change, slot 06:00 fires twice, soaking the herb bed. Fix: store UTC, convert at display. Repro on the Oakhollow test rig only. To reproduce, install the firmware identified by the token below.

build token for hafop-kahog: htk31_a432ac515d5bb1362002c1e1a7e80ef

The FeeForge rules engine, which computes shipping fees for Marlowe Mercantile checkouts, is intermittently failing to reach its rules database since the 14:20 deploy. Symptoms: pool acquisition timeouts every few minutes, fee evaluation falling back to cached rules. Restarting the service clears it for roughly an hour. Suspect a leaked connection in the new tier-lookup path. On-call: please enable pool tracing and capture a leak report. Use the staging database via the connection string below.

replica DSN, kagaf-kajef: postgresql://eliius_svc:UA@db-a408.paliqnet.internal:5432/istys

Runbook note from the Velmora cache postmortem: last Tuesday's stale-cache bug stemmed from the Quillstone edge layer serving expired fragments after the TTL rollover. Mitigation is in place — we now force a purge on every deploy of the catalog service. The purge hook calls the invalidation endpoint, which requires authentication since the Harvale incident. Before running the purge script locally, add the following line to your .env so the hook can authenticate:

env line for fafof-fahag: LEDGER_TOKEN5=f8790